Merits of Joint Family

Joint family system enjoys following merits:

  1. Division of Labor: In the joint family the division of labor is maintained. Every member in the family is given work according to his abilities.  Family’s work is managed by all members including the women and children and it creates a good performance on work. 
  2. Economy: Joint living enjoys economy of expenditure because as the things are consumed in large quantities and low prices. In this way a large family can be maintained work to participate all.
  3. Leisure: The joint family provides a lot of time for all. The female members of the family divide their household work within the female members. They finish their work within little time spending and rest of time is leisure. It promotes the feeling of comfort among the members.
  4. Social Insurance: In the joint family, the orphans and incapable find a comfortable asylum. Similarly widows are assured of their proper living in joint family. The old, the sick and the incapacitated can depend on the joint family. This is one of the happiest sides of a joint family system.
  5. Promotion of Social Virtues: It raises great social virtues like sacrifices, love, co-operation, selfless service, broad mind among the members of the family. Elders want to check the Younger's behavior. They are prevented the younger to get lost from their path and they help to use self-control. These checks help in building a social moral character.
  6. Check on Fragmentation of Holdings: Joint family system ‘puts a check on the fragmentation of holdings and evils inherent therein. Besides this it helps to increase production for family. Because their use a vast land. 
  7. Socialistic Organization: According to Henry Maine, “the joint family is like a corporation, the trustee of which is the farther. Everyone in the joint family earns according to his capacity but gets according to his needs”.
